What defines a digitized supply chain?

A digitized supply chain is based on an integrated control system that connects all areas involved in real time. Purchasing, production, warehousing, transport, and customer service are digitally interlinked, enabling a continuous flow of information. This creates an overall picture that provides transparency and facilitates the coordination of complex processes.

This approach focuses on integration: instead of isolated individual functions, end-to-end processes with a uniform database are created. As a result, companies can react more quickly, plan better, and manage their operations according to the situation. This creates traceability, reduces risks, and improves cross-departmental information exchange along the value chain.

Digitalization in supply chain management (SCM) is closely linked to the concept of Industry 4.0, combining physical processes with digital technologies and opening up new control options. The potential is particularly evident in the area of Logistics 4.0: real-time data, automation, and networking increase transparency and response speed, making the supply chain a key success factor for sustainable growth.

 

Why many supply chains are reaching their limits

Many companies work with outdated or separate systems. Data is stored in silos and transferred manually, giving no consistent overview of processes, inventories, and capacities, leading to delays and coordination problems. Typical weaknesses of traditional supply chains:

  • Isolated data islands: Information is stored in separate systems and is not consistently consolidated.
  • Lack of transparency: Companies do not have a consistent overview of the flow of goods from supplier to customer.
  • No real-time information: Decisions are based on outdated data on inventory, delivery status, or demand.
  • Low agility: Processes can only be adapted slowly in the event of disruptions or fluctuations in demand.
  • Weak risk management: Risks such as delivery failures or bottlenecks are identified too late.
  • Organizational barriers: Departments and external partners are not sufficiently aligned with common processes and information flows.

These weaknesses reduce the performance of the supply chain. Response times are longer, scheduling becomes inaccurate, and customer requirements often remain unfulfilled. The digitalization of supply chain management is therefore a key lever for ensuring long-term competitiveness.

Advantages of digital supply chains

Digital supply chains offer companies clear competitive advantages: they enable a continuous flow of information across all process stages – from procurement to delivery. Real-time data increases planning accuracy and shortens response times in the event of disruptions.

Automated processes reduce manual effort, lower error rates, and increase efficiency. At the same time, data-based analyses create a sound basis for decision-making and strengthen companies' ability to control their business in dynamic markets.

 

What digital supply chains must deliver strategically

Digital supply chains solve key weaknesses in traditional delivery networks through end-to-end connectivity, intelligent data analysis, and close collaboration. Effective supply chain monitoring helps to identify changes early on and take targeted countermeasures. This requires a robust, data-driven system with a focus on transparency, agility, and collaboration.

  • End-to-end transparency: Relevant information is available at all times for targeted control across all stages.
  • Forecasting capability: Data-based predictions support anticipatory planning and responsive adjustments.
  • Resilience: Digital structures ensure delivery capability even in exceptional situations.
  • Data-driven decisions: Up-to-date data improves the quality and speed of decision-making processes.
  • Collaboration: Consistent information flows strengthen coordination between all parties involved.

Digital supply chains link up planning and implementation across departments and company boundaries. They enable faster decisions, coordinated action, and greater adaptability in dynamic markets.

 

Technological drivers for modern supply chains

Digitalization in supply chain management (SCM) is changing how companies organize their operational processes and make informed business decisions. Networked IT systems manage processes more efficiently, create transparency, and help companies to digitize their logistics and establish an intelligent supply chain. The coordinated use of modern applications and technologies is crucial in this regard.

 

Analytics and forecasts as a basis for decision-making

Advanced analytics and AI-supported forecasts are key components of supply chain digitalization, as they analyze large amounts of data, identify patterns, and deliver actionable insights as a basis for decision-making. This enables companies to plan their requirements more accurately, identify risks at an early stage, and adapt processes in a targeted manner.

 

Digital mapping of complex supply networks

A digital twin of the supply chain enables real processes to be mapped virtually. This allows scenarios to be simulated and the effects of decisions to be tested without taking any operational risks, improving strategic control in dynamic markets.

 

Technological infrastructure for networking and efficiency

A powerful IT infrastructure is central to supply chain digitalization. Cloud technologies and integrated systems ensure cross-company data availability, automated workflows, and low-error process control, creating a stable, adaptable, and forward-looking supply chain.

 

Digitalization of the supply chain: Applications with strategic added value

Digital technologies are changing supply chain management far beyond logistical processes. As they open up new opportunities for proactive planning and improved collaboration with partners, these solutions must be used in a coordinated manner. Examples of digitalization along the supply chain are:

  • Digital demand forecasts: These combine internal data with market developments. This enables purchasing to identify demand at an early stage and time orders more effectively, reducing storage costs and avoiding supply bottlenecks.
  • Networked production planning: Production systems, procurement, and inventory management are directly interlinked. Capacities can be allocated efficiently, and disruptions can be compensated for more quickly. This increases utilization and minimizes losses.
  • Platform-based supplier integration: Digital platforms enable continuous data exchange as all parties involved work with the same level of information. This improves delivery reliability and facilitates coordination.

Supply chain digitalization supports key business objectives: higher planning quality, lower risks, and stable partnerships. Through the systematic integration of digital applications, companies strengthen their adaptability and gain strategic management expertise.

Success factors for sustainable supply chain digitalization

For supply chain digitalization to succeed, clear strategic goals, structured responsibilities, and internal expertise are required. Companies should collaborate across departments and actively manage digitalization projects.

Consistent data standards, interdisciplinary teams, and robust change management are key prerequisites. Digital transformation can only have a lasting effect if it is widely accepted throughout the company. The introduction of a reliable data strategy ensures that information is accurate, usable, and available at all times.

External partner networks provide additional support through specialized expertise and accelerate implementation. It is crucial that technology, organization, and corporate culture mesh seamlessly, to create a solid foundation for a sustainable, digitized supply chain.

FAQs on supply chain digitalization

What are the benefits of supply chain digitalization?

Supply chain digitalization increases transparency, responsiveness, and forecasting reliability. Companies can identify risks earlier and manage processes in a more targeted manner tostrengthen the stability and competitiveness of the supply chain.

 

What characterizes a digital supply chain?

A digital supply chain is based on integrated, networked processes along the entire delivery chain. All relevant data is available consistently and in real time, meaning decisions can be based on shared information rather than isolated systems.

 

What technologies are needed for a digital supply chain?

Key components include integrated platforms, cloud solutions, data analytics, and AI-supported forecasts. They connect processes, evaluate data, and support control. The goal is coordinated interaction.

 

Why do digitalization projects in the supply chain fail?

Often, there is a lack of defined goals, an overarching data strategy, or organizational commitment. A lack of coordination between departments also slows down implementation. Without change management, technological investments remain ineffective.

 

What is the difference between logistics and supply chain?

Logistics focuses on transport, storage, and distribution. The supply chain also includes purchasing, production, planning, and partner management. Supply chain digitalization takes a holistic view of these areas.
